
Почему FPGA в облаке в 2026?
В 2026 году облачные FPGA перестали быть экзотикой, став прагматичным выбором. Главный козырь — это, конечно, экономическая целесообразность. Зачем покупать дорогущую «железку», которая морально устареет через пару лет, если можно арендровать именно ту мощность, которая нужна здесь и сейчас? Это кардинально меняет подход к разработке и развёртыванию высокопроизводительных решений, от машинного обучения до финансового моделирования. Доступность и гибкость — вот новые мантры.
Тренды и преимущества
К 2026 году облачные FPGA из экзотики превращаются в мейнстрим. Главный тренд — это их демократизация, когда доступ к мощным чипам получают даже небольшие команды, не вкладываясь в «железо». Эластичность ресурсов и модель «плати за использование» кардинально снижают порог входа. Появляются готовые сервисы для машинного обучения и обработки потоковых данных, что делает разработку невероятно быстрой. В общем, будущее — за гибридными вычислениями, где FPGA в облаке становится таким же привычным инструментом, как и виртуальные машины.
Сравнение с локальными решениями
Облачные FPGA, конечно, не отменяют локальные стенды, но кардинально меняют расклад сил. Покупка собственной платы — это солидные капитальные затраты и, что скрывать, головная боль с настройкой «железа». Облако же превращает это в операционные расходы, предлагая невиданную гибкость. Захотел протестировать новую архитектуру — арендовал нужный экземпляр на час, а не ждал поставки оборудования месяц. Правда, для задач, требующих минимальных задержок и полной изоляции, локальное решение пока вне конкуренции.
Выбор облачного провайдера
Ключевой момент — выбор вендора. AWS EC2 F1, Intel DevCloud или, скажем, специализированные предложения от Nimbix? Каждый обладает уникальным набором FPGA-плат, инструментов и, что немаловажно, ценовых моделей. Сравнивайте не только стоимость, но и экосистему: доступные AMI, поддержку фреймворков вроде Vitis или OpenCL. Порог входа может существенно разниться.
Обзор лидеров рынка
К 2026 году облачный ландшафт для FPGA-разработки заметно консолидировался. Бесспорными титанами здесь выступают AWS EC2 F1 и Microsoft Azure с семейством VMs-P. Их экосистемы, честно говоря, поражают своей зрелостью. Однако, набирают обороты и более нишевые игроки, вроде Nimbix, предлагающие порой более гибкие тарифные модели для специфичных задач. Интересно, что классические хостинг-провайдеры тоже начали подключаться к этой гонке, хотя пока и с заметным отставанием.
Ключевые критерии выбора
Выбирая облачную платформу для FPGA, стоит задуматься не только о стоимости, но и о доступности готовых образов (AMI/VHD) и инструментов для разработки. Очень важно оценить, насколько легко масштабировать проект и интегрировать его с другими сервисами, например, для обработки больших данных. В конечном счёте, выбор зависит от конкретной задачи — будь то высокопроизводительные вычисления или эмуляция ASIC.
Практические шаги для старта
Первым делом определитесь с поставщиком облачных услуг. AWS EC2 F1, Intel DevCloud или, возможно, альтернативные платформы — у каждого свои тонкости. Затем, что крайне важно, подготовьте свою среду разработки: установите необходимые инструменты и загрузите битстримы. После этого можно приступать к развёртыванию инстанса и загрузке вашего первого проекта. Это не так страшно, как кажется!
Создание и настройка аккаунта
Первым делом, конечно, регистрируетесь у одного из крупных облачных провайдеров — AWS, Google Cloud или Azure. После подтверждения почты и телефона (стандартная процедура) настоятельно рекомендую сразу настроить двухфакторную аутентификацию. Безопасность платежей и проектов — это святое. Затем в панели управления активируете доступ к сервисам FPGA, что иногда требует отдельного запроса.
Запуск первого инстанса
Итак, вы определились с провайдером. Первый шаг — выбор инстанса. Вам предстоит не просто подобрать виртуальную машину, а найти специфический тип, поддерживающий FPGA. Обратите внимание на образы системы — многие облака предлагают предварительно настроенные варианты с уже установленными инструментами для работы с аппаратурой. Это сильно экономит время, поверьте.
После запуска инстанса ключевой момент — доступ к FPGA. Обычно он предоставляется не напрямую, а через специальный драйвер или SDK, который нужно установить и сконфигурировать. Не пропустите этот шаг, иначе ваша дорогостоящая плата будет просто молчать.












































